1. XLR Inputs
XLR inputs are the go - to choice for many audio professionals, especially when it comes to microphones. These inputs are known for their balanced signal transmission, which means they can carry audio signals over long distances without picking up much interference.
The 3 - pin XLR connector has a positive, negative, and ground wire. The balanced design cancels out any external noise that might be picked up along the cable. This is crucial in live sound situations where you might have a lot of electrical equipment around, like in a concert hall or a large event space.

2. TRS Inputs
TRS (Tip, Ring, Sleeve) inputs are another common type of input on pro mixers. They are often used for connecting line - level sources, such as keyboards, synthesizers, and audio interfaces.
TRS cables can carry both balanced and unbalanced signals, depending on the application. For balanced signals, they work in a similar way to XLR cables, providing good noise rejection. Unbalanced TRS connections are typically used for shorter cable runs and lower - impedance sources.
One of the advantages of TRS inputs is their versatility. You can use them to connect a wide variety of audio devices. For instance, if you're a music producer using a digital audio workstation (DAW), you can connect your audio interface to the mixer via TRS cables. 3. RCA Inputs
RCA inputs are more commonly associated with consumer audio equipment, but they also have a place in pro mixers. These inputs are typically used for connecting unbalanced sources, such as CD players, DVD players, or some older audio devices.
RCA cables are relatively inexpensive and easy to find. They are great for adding some legacy audio equipment to your pro mixer setup. For example, if you have an old vinyl turntable that you want to incorporate into your live sound or recording setup, you can use RCA inputs on the mixer to do so.
However, it's important to note that RCA connections are unbalanced, which means they are more susceptible to noise and interference compared to balanced connections like XLR or balanced TRS. So, you might want to keep the cable runs short when using RCA inputs to minimize the chance of noise issues.
4. USB Inputs
In the digital age, USB inputs have become increasingly important on pro mixers. These inputs allow you to connect your mixer directly to a computer or other digital devices.
With a USB connection, you can perform tasks like recording audio directly from the mixer to your computer's hard drive. This is incredibly useful for musicians, podcasters, and audio engineers who want to capture high - quality audio recordings. You can also use USB inputs to run software applications that are specifically designed for the mixer, such as digital effects processors or mixer control software.

5. MIDI Inputs
MIDI (Musical Instrument Digital Interface) inputs are essential for musicians and producers who work with electronic musical instruments. These inputs allow you to connect MIDI - enabled devices, such as synthesizers, drum machines, and MIDI controllers, to the mixer.
When you connect a MIDI device to a mixer via MIDI inputs, you can transmit control information between the devices. This means you can use one MIDI controller to control multiple synthesizers or other MIDI - enabled devices connected to the mixer. For example, you can use a single MIDI keyboard to play different sounds on several synthesizers at the same time.
MIDI also allows for synchronization between different devices. This is crucial in a live performance or recording situation where you need all your electronic instruments to play in perfect time. 6. High - Impedance (Hi - Z) Inputs
High - impedance inputs are designed for connecting high - impedance sources, such as electric guitars and basses. These inputs are different from the standard line - level or microphone inputs because they can handle the high - impedance signals produced by these instruments without loading them down.
When you plug an electric guitar or bass directly into a regular line - level input, you might get a dull or distorted sound because the input impedance is not compatible with the instrument. A Hi - Z input solves this problem by providing a high - impedance load that matches the output impedance of the guitar or bass.
This allows you to capture the natural sound of the instrument directly from the source.
